Of course I love a house with a story! This was originally built by the Savin brothers who were carriage makers in their day. There are similarities in this house to what you might find in a carriage as well. Just take a look at that gingerbread work above the porch! Then inside you’ll find the wide plank woodfloors, a large fireplace in the dining room, and huge windows in the master bedroom. You can see the care that they put into designing this house. It comes through in every detail.

Step into a rare historic masterpiece with this 170+ years home, proudly built by the renowned Savin Brothers, famed carriage makers of Maury County. Nestled in the prestigious Athenaeum Historic District, this 4-bedroom, 3-bath home spans 3,230 sq. ft. on a generous .67-acre lot. From the moment you arrive, its rich heritage and exquisite craftsmanship shine through—original wood plank floors, intricate gingerbread detailing, broad moldings, and well-preserved plaster walls tell the story of a bygone era. Thoughtfully modernized with all-new windows, a recent roof, and an updated HVAC system, this home perfectly blends historic character with modern comfort.
